About Pantrangi Manasa
Pantrangi Manasa is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Ceramics and Composites,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 23 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(12 papers), Glass properties and applications (11 papers), Solid State Laser Technologies (8 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(6 papers), Advancements in Battery Materials (5 papers),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(4 papers),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(3 papers) and Conducting polymers and applications (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ceramics and Composites (390 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(429 citations), Materials Chemistry (554 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(515 citations) and Polymers and Plastics (113 citations). Pantrangi Manasa has collaborated with scholars based in China, India and Thailand. Frequent co-authors include Fen Ran, C.K. Jayasankar, Sambasivam Sangaraju, A. Madhu, B. Eraiah, Ch. Basavapoornima, Long Kang, Qianghong Wu, Lingyang Liu and Ying Liu.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Luminescence, Journal of Power Sources, Optical Materials, Journal of Energy Storage and Journal of Materials Chemistry A.
